Latest Patents

Bayne holds a patent for a high-pressure series arc discharge lamp construction. This invention features a 1000 watt arc discharge arc tube assembly that comprises two series connected side-by-side arc discharge tubes. The combined breakdown voltage is sufficient for a standard 2-5 kV starting pulse to simultaneously start both arc tubes without the need for additional structure. The design allows for the use of a standard ballast, starter, and fixture, with an overall length of less than 300 millimeters. The lamps are spaced sufficiently apart to prevent detrimental heat transfer effects on one another while being close enough to act as a single source of light in standard fixtures that typically employ lamps with a single discharge tube.
